GUTTER-LINE Seamless GRP Gutter Lining System.

A Permanent Solution to leaking Valley Gutters both Commercial & Domestic.

GUTTER-LINE fibreglass linings are built in situ, virtually eliminating the need for stripping out of glazing bars, roof sheets, closure panels and flashings. Using the very latest GRP technology combined with tried and tested yacht construction techniques we can produce an independent lining to most valley gutters.

 

Because we use part preformed materials in the on-site construction of our gutter linings, we are normally able to increase the size and volume of each gutter and offer the option of introducing more outlets, insulation and weir ends etc. (see our FAQ's page).
The GUTTER-LINE GRP lining is seamless, structural and lightweight. The completed lining has great strength and durability and will not be effected by foot traffic, even where regular access is required. A range of surface finishes and colours are also available.

Adjacent cappings, cladding and flashings can also be incorporated into the GRP structure, encapsulating failed render or failed copings permanently.

The main component of the GUTTER-LINE system is the preformed GRP base layer, FLEX-BASE.
Once the FLEX-BASE sheet has been cut to size it is fixed into position within the gutter, forming both upstands, the base layer, weir ends and outlets etc. Wet laid fibreglass is then used to laminate the lining sheets together, forming an intrinsically waterproof and independent gutter lining.
The base (sole) of the gutter is then reinforced with a synthetic core material, sandwiched between additional layers of glassfibre. To complete the gutter lining, a layer of lightfast polyester Gel-coat (flow-coat) resin is applied, normally lead grey although other colours are available (imitation lead/stone work has successfully installed at period properties and even listed buildings).

The finished structure should far exceed the 20 year guarantee period.
